YOSEC E-816C
YOSEC Fireproof Gun Safe Lock Replacement E-816C
Instruction Manual
Product Overview
This manual provides instructions for the installation, operation, and maintenance of your YOSEC E-816C Electronic Digital Keypad Lock. This lock is designed as a replacement for gun safes and DIY safe boxes, featuring a chrome finish and robust security features.
Key features include a 1-8 digit programmable code, a 3-error code lockout mechanism, and a low battery warning. The keypad diameter is 100mm (3.74 inches).

Specifications
| Brand | YOSEC |
| Model Number | E-816C |
| Lock Type | Electronic Digital Keypad |
| Material | Metal |
| Finish | Chrome |
| Keypad Diameter | 100mm (3.74 inches) |
| Power Source | One 9V Lithium Cell Battery (not included) |
| Code Length | 1-8 Digits |
| Lockout Feature | After 3 incorrect code entries |
| Special Feature | Anti-Peeping Password, Sound/Silent Operation |

Operating Instructions
1. Opening the Lock
To open the lock, enter your 1-8 digit code followed by the '#' key. The factory default code is typically 159. If the code is correct, the lock will emit a sound (if sound is enabled) and the solenoid will retract, allowing you to open the safe door.
Image: Detailed view of the electronic keypad, showing the numerical buttons and special function keys.
2. Changing the User Code
Detailed instructions for changing the user code are typically provided with the lock's internal PCB or a separate quick guide. Generally, the process involves:
- Entering the current code to open the lock.
- Pressing a designated programming button (often on the PCB) or a specific key sequence on the keypad.
- Entering the new 1-8 digit code.
- Confirming the new code.
- Always test the new code multiple times with the safe door open before closing it.
3. Silent Mode Operation
The lock can be programmed for silent operation, disabling the buzzer sound. Refer to the specific instructions provided with your lock's PCB for the key sequence to toggle sound on/off.
4. Low Battery Warning
The lock features a low battery warning. When the battery is low, the keypad may emit a series of beeps or a specific light indicator will flash after entering a code. Replace the battery promptly when this warning occurs.
5. Lockout Feature
If 3 incorrect codes are entered consecutively, the lock will enter a lockout mode for 20 seconds, preventing further attempts. Wait for the lockout period to expire before trying again.

Maintenance
1. Battery Replacement
To replace the 9V battery:
- Ensure the safe is open.
- Carefully remove the keypad face by pressing the tab counterclockwise or following the specific instructions for your model to access the battery compartment.
- Remove the old 9V battery.
- Insert a new 9V lithium cell battery, observing polarity.
- Reattach the keypad face.
- Test the lock operation.
2. Cleaning
Wipe the keypad surface with a soft, dry cloth. Do not use abrasive cleaners or solvents, as these can damage the finish or electronic components.
Troubleshooting
| Problem | Possible Cause | Solution |
|---|---|---|
| Keypad does not respond. | Dead or low battery. Incorrect battery installation. Loose connection. | Replace the 9V battery. Check battery polarity. Ensure all wiring connections are secure. |
| Lock does not open after entering code. | Incorrect code entered. Lockout mode active. Solenoid malfunction. | Verify the correct code. Wait 20 seconds if in lockout mode. Check solenoid connection and function. |
| Low battery warning (beeping/flashing light). | Battery is low. | Replace the 9V battery immediately. |
| Cannot change code. | Incorrect programming sequence. | Refer to the specific programming instructions for your lock's PCB. Ensure the safe is open during code change. |
